Delete Duplicate Products for WooCommerce Security & Risk Analysis

wordpress.org/plugins/delete-duplicate-products-for-woocommerce

Quickly find and manage duplicate WooCommerce products. Bulk delete, image control, action logging, 301 redirects, and CSV export.

900 active installs v1.4.0 PHP 7.4+ WP 5.8+ Updated Mar 6, 2026
301-redirectscleanupdelete-duplicate-productsduplicate-productsproduct-management
100
A · Safe
CVEs total0
Unpatched0
Last CVENever
Download
Safety Verdict

Is Delete Duplicate Products for WooCommerce Safe to Use in 2026?

Generally Safe

Score 100/100

Delete Duplicate Products for WooCommerce has no known CVEs and is actively maintained. It's a solid choice for most WordPress installations.

No known CVEs Updated 2mo ago
Risk Assessment

The plugin 'delete-duplicate-products-for-woocommerce' v1.4.0 exhibits a generally strong security posture, with no known historical vulnerabilities and excellent adherence to secure coding practices in static analysis. The plugin demonstrates a high percentage of prepared statements for SQL queries and properly escaped outputs, indicating a good understanding of preventing common web vulnerabilities like SQL injection and cross-site scripting. The presence of nonce and capability checks further strengthens its defense against unauthorized actions. The limited attack surface with zero entry points and a complete lack of external HTTP requests are also positive indicators. However, a single taint flow with unsanitized paths, even if not rated critical or high, represents a potential area of concern that warrants attention. This suggests a minor weakness in input sanitization that could be exploited in certain scenarios, although its impact is mitigated by the absence of historical vulnerabilities. Overall, the plugin is well-developed from a security perspective, but this one identified taint flow should be investigated and remediated to ensure complete robustness.

Key Concerns

  • Taint flow with unsanitized paths (High severity)
Vulnerabilities
None known

Delete Duplicate Products for WooCommerce Security Vulnerabilities

No known vulnerabilities — this is a good sign.
Version History

Delete Duplicate Products for WooCommerce Release Timeline

v1.4.0Current
v1.3.0
v1.2.0
v1.1.1
v1.1.0
v1.0.0
Code Analysis
Analyzed Mar 16, 2026

Delete Duplicate Products for WooCommerce Code Analysis

Dangerous Functions
0
Raw SQL Queries
2
26 prepared
Unescaped Output
6
160 escaped
Nonce Checks
7
Capability Checks
5
File Operations
0
External Requests
0
Bundled Libraries
1

Bundled Libraries

Freemius1.0

SQL Query Safety

93% prepared28 total queries

Output Escaping

96% escaped166 total outputs
Data Flows · Security
1 unsanitized

Data Flow Analysis

4 flows1 with unsanitized paths
cptsm2_render_action_logs_page (delete-duplicate-products-for-woocommerce.php:1361)
Source (user input) Sink (dangerous op) Sanitizer Transform Unsanitized Sanitized
Attack Surface

Delete Duplicate Products for WooCommerce Attack Surface

Entry Points0
Unprotected0
WordPress Hooks 10
actionbefore_woocommerce_initdelete-duplicate-products-for-woocommerce.php:58
actionadmin_menudelete-duplicate-products-for-woocommerce.php:172
actionadmin_enqueue_scriptsdelete-duplicate-products-for-woocommerce.php:173
actionadmin_post_cptsm2_delete_productsdelete-duplicate-products-for-woocommerce.php:176
actionadmin_post_cptsm2_export_csvdelete-duplicate-products-for-woocommerce.php:177
actionsave_post_productdelete-duplicate-products-for-woocommerce.php:179
actiondeleted_postdelete-duplicate-products-for-woocommerce.php:180
actionwoocommerce_save_product_variationdelete-duplicate-products-for-woocommerce.php:181
actioninitdelete-duplicate-products-for-woocommerce.php:183
actiontemplate_redirectdelete-duplicate-products-for-woocommerce.php:185
Maintenance & Trust

Delete Duplicate Products for WooCommerce Maintenance & Trust

Maintenance Signals

WordPress version tested6.9.4
Last updatedMar 6, 2026
PHP min version7.4
Downloads6K

Community Trust

Rating80/100
Number of ratings4
Active installs900
Developer Profile

Delete Duplicate Products for WooCommerce Developer Profile

Luis Peel

4 plugins · 1K total installs

93
trust score
Avg Security Score
98/100
Avg Patch Time
30 days
View full developer profile
Detection Fingerprints

How We Detect Delete Duplicate Products for WooCommerce

Patterns used to identify this plugin on WordPress sites during automated security audits and web crawling.

Asset Fingerprints

Asset Paths
/wp-content/plugins/delete-duplicate-products-for-woocommerce/css/style.css/wp-content/plugins/delete-duplicate-products-for-woocommerce/js/main.js/wp-content/plugins/delete-duplicate-products-for-woocommerce/js/products.js
Script Paths
/wp-content/plugins/delete-duplicate-products-for-woocommerce/js/main.js/wp-content/plugins/delete-duplicate-products-for-woocommerce/js/products.js
Version Parameters
delete-duplicate-products-for-woocommerce/css/style.css?ver=delete-duplicate-products-for-woocommerce/js/main.js?ver=delete-duplicate-products-for-woocommerce/js/products.js?ver=

HTML / DOM Fingerprints

CSS Classes
cptsm2-duplicate-products-wrappercptsm2-notice-errorcptsm2-product-itemcptsm2-duplicate-countcptsm2-bulk-actions-formcptsm2-action-log-tablecptsm2-redirect-table
HTML Comments
<!-- Main class for handling duplicate products --><!-- Initialize the plugin --><!-- Plugin activation hook - Initialize database tables --><!-- Table for action logging -->+2 more
Data Attributes
data-action-log-noncedata-redirect-noncedata-delete-nonce
JS Globals
window.cptsm2_ajax_objectvar cptsm2_ajax_object
REST Endpoints
/wp-json/cptsm2/v1/logs/wp-json/cptsm2/v1/redirects
FAQ

Frequently Asked Questions about Delete Duplicate Products for WooCommerce